1. A power controlling apparatus applied to a biochip, the biochip comprising M regions, M being a positive integer, each of the M regions comprising a plurality of cells, the power controlling apparatus comprising:

  • a pulse generating module, for generating a pulse;

    a combinational circuit receiving the pulse for generating M controlling signals, each controlling signal with a predetermined phase different from the phase of the other controlling signals; and

    M controlling modules electrically connected to the combinational circuit, each of the M controlling signals corresponding to and for activating one of the M controlling modules to selectively power on one corresponding region of the M regions;

    wherein the cells in the corresponding region which is powered have an action potential refractory period longer than an interval of a power-on time of the corresponding region.
